What is IP Law?

IP Law, also known as Intellectual Property Law, refers to the legal framework that protects creations of the mind. These creations may include:

  • Brand names and logos
  • Business inventions
  • Written and artistic work
  • Software and digital content
  • Product designs
  • Trade secrets

The purpose of IP Law is simple: to give creators legal ownership over what they create and prevent others from copying or profiting from it without permission.

Types of Intellectual Property Protected Under IP Law

Understanding the different types of intellectual property is important for choosing the right legal protection.

1. Trademark Protection

A trademark protects your brand identity. This includes:

  • Business name
  • Company logo
  • Slogans
  • Product names
  • Brand symbols

For example, if your company has a unique logo or brand name, trademark registration ensures that no one else can legally use it.

2. Copyright Protection

Copyright protects original creative work such as:

  • Website content
  • Books and articles
  • Music
  • Videos
  • Software
  • Artwork
  • Photographs

Many businesses unknowingly lose valuable content because they fail to secure copyright protection.

With proper copyright registration, you can legally stop others from copying or using your work without permission.

3. Patent Protection

Patents protect inventions and new innovations.

This may include:

  • New technologies
  • Machines
  • Medical products
  • Manufacturing processes
  • Software innovations

If you have developed something unique, patent registration ensures exclusive legal ownership.

Without patent protection, competitors can copy your invention and profit from your hard work.

4. Industrial Design Protection

Industrial design rights protect the visual appearance of a product, such as:

  • Packaging
  • Product shape
  • Fashion designs
  • Product layouts

For businesses selling physical products, this is a powerful legal tool.

5. Trade Secrets

Trade secrets include confidential business information such as:

  • Customer lists
  • Recipes
  • Manufacturing methods
  • Marketing strategies
  • Internal systems

Common IP Mistakes Businesses Make

Delaying Trademark Registration

Many businesses wait too long to register their brand name. By then, someone else may already own it legally.

Assuming Online Content is Automatically Protected

Although some rights exist automatically, formal registration provides stronger legal protection.

Ignoring Employee Contracts

Without proper agreements, employees or contractors may claim ownership of work they created.

Not Monitoring IP Infringement

If someone copies your work and you fail to act, it weakens your legal position.

FAQ Section

What is IP Law?

IP Law protects creations like trademarks, copyrights, patents, and trade secrets.

Why is trademark registration important?

It prevents others from using your business name or logo.

Can software be protected under IP Law?

Yes, software can be protected through copyright and sometimes patents.

How long does trademark registration take in Pakistan?

It generally takes 12–18 months depending on the process.

Do startups need IP protection?

Yes. Startups often rely heavily on intellectual property for growth and investment.
